Transaction dda5d972956e9489a370fe75abbb6a43d86d6c9552cbfc04256180aea6de0f4b
1 Input
1 Output
-
dda5d972956e9489a370fe75abbb6a43d86d6c9552cbfc04256180aea6de0f4b:0
- value
- 22407834
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 adca11c459dcc6016b7c4dbcec73b60a269cf94b OP_EQUAL
- address
- 3HXvtkxHArhKNxfsMN2ZVbYjUnvRbAd9uz